The Ultimate Buying Guide for Women’s Walking Shoes with Wide Toe Boxes

Finding the right walking shoe is important for happy feet. For many women, standard shoes squeeze their toes. A wide toe box lets your toes spread out naturally. This means more comfort, especially on long walks. This guide helps you choose the best pair.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ping, focus on these main features. They make a big difference in how the shoe feels and performs.

  • True Wide Toe Box: The front part of the shoe must be wide. Your toes should wiggle freely without touching the sides or the top.
  • Sufficient Heel-to-Toe Drop: This is the height difference between your heel and your toes. A lower drop (4mm to 8mm) often feels more natural for walking.
  • Good Cushioning: You need enough padding to absorb impact. Look for responsive foam that cushions your step but does not feel mushy.
  • Stable Midsole: The middle part of the shoe should offer support. It keeps your foot from rolling too much inward or outward.
  • Breathable Upper Material: Your feet sweat when you walk. Breathable materials keep your feet cool and dry.

Important Materials in Wide Toe Box Shoes

The materials used directly impact comfort, durability, and weight.

Upper Materials:
  • Engineered Mesh: This is very popular. It stretches slightly and breathes well. It helps accommodate different foot shapes.
  • Knit Fabrics: Similar to mesh, knit uppers offer a sock-like fit. They conform well to the foot without pinching the wide toe area.
  • Leather (Less Common): Some premium or casual walking shoes use leather. It is durable but often less breathable than mesh.
Sole Materials:
  • EVA (Ethylene-Vinyl Acetate): This foam is lightweight and provides excellent shock absorption. It is the standard for most cushioned walking shoes.
  • Rubber Outsoles: The bottom layer needs rubber for traction. Look for durable rubber placed in high-wear areas like the heel and forefoot.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Shoe Quality

Not all wide toe box shoes are created equal. Pay attention to construction details.

Quality Boosters:
  • Stitching and Seams: Smooth, flat seams inside the shoe reduce the chance of rubbing or blisters.
  • Removable Insoles: High-quality shoes allow you to take out the insole. This lets you use custom orthotics if you need them.
  • Durable Midsole: A midsole that keeps its bounce over many miles is a sign of quality engineering.
Quality Reducers:
  • Stiff Toe Box Edges: If the front edge of the sole is too rigid, it forces your toes into an unnatural shape, defeating the purpose of the wide box.
  • Thin, Cheap Foam: Low-quality foam compresses quickly. The shoe will feel flat after only a few weeks of use.
  • Poor Arch Support: Even with a wide toe box, poor arch support leads to foot fatigue and pain.
User Experience and Use Cases

Think about where and how often you walk. This shapes your ideal shoe choice.

For Daily Errands and Casual Wear:

You need something lightweight and easy to slip on. Comfort is key over high performance. Look for stylish designs that match everyday clothes.

For Long Distance Walking or Fitness Walking:

These walks demand more structure. Choose shoes with excellent energy return in the midsole. They should offer good lockdown around the midfoot so your foot stays secure even with the wide front.

For Walking on Uneven Terrain:

If you walk on trails or gravel paths, you need better grip. Look for deeper lugs (treads) on the outsole. The upper material should offer some protection against small debris.


10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Wide Toe Box Walking Shoes

Q: What is the main benefit of a wide toe box?

A: The main benefit is natural foot splay. It prevents painful issues like bunions, hammertoes, and general toe cramping.

Q: Does “wide” mean the whole shoe is bigger?

A: No. A wide toe box specifically means the forefoot area is broader. The heel and midfoot might still fit true to size.

Q: Should I size up if I buy a wide shoe?

A: Generally, you should stick to your normal size. Sizing up might make the shoe too long, causing your foot to slide forward and hit the front.

Q: How can I test if the toe box is wide enough?

A: Put the shoe on and wiggle your toes. You should be able to move them side-to-side easily. Also, look down at your foot inside the shoe; it should not look pinched.

Q: Are wide toe box shoes good for high arches?

A: Yes, many brands that make wide toe boxes also offer excellent arch support. You must check the insole or consider adding an insert.

Q: Do these shoes look bulky?

A: Newer models look much better than older ones. Many modern designs keep the heel sleek while only widening the front section.

Q: What is the difference between “zero drop” and a wide toe box?

A: Zero drop means the heel and toe are at the same level. A wide toe box refers only to the width in the front. They are separate features, but many minimalist shoes offer both.

Q: How long should a new pair last?

A: For regular walking (3-5 times a week), a good quality pair should last between 300 and 500 miles before the cushioning significantly breaks down.

Q: Are these shoes only for people with foot problems?

A: No. Many healthy walkers choose them because they allow the foot to function naturally, which promotes better long-term foot health.

Q: What is the best time of day to try on wide shoes?

A: Try them on in the late afternoon or evening. Your feet naturally swell throughout the day, mimicking how they will feel after a long walk.
